OTTAWA – An Orleans man has pleaded guilty to second-degree murder in the killing his mother, and has been sentenced to life in jail.
In a Thursday court appearance, Chris Gobin, 19, admitted that back in April of 2014, he choked his mother Luce Lavertu, before stabbing her and cutting her neck.
Gobin said he had argued with his mom that morning about going to school, and he overreacted when she tried to force him to go.
Gobin was emotional in court and broke down sobbing, saying he loves and misses his mother.
The defence pointed out that a psychiatric assessment showed Gobin had a history of depression and anxiety.
Gobin will be eligible for parole in 12 years, and the judge has recommend he get mental health treatment while in jail.
